Collaboration with Experts
Leading this research is Shilpi Nayak, Co-Founder and CTO of Goodfin, in collaboration with Professor Srikanth Jagabathula from NYU Stern. Their study explores the capabilities of AI in passing the CFA Level III standards, an indicator of proficiency in investment management.
Understanding the Research Findings
The research titled Advanced Financial Reasoning at Scale: A Comprehensive Evaluation of Large Language Models on CFA Level III marks a significant advance in AI evaluation against the CFA standards. Evaluating various AI models, including those from OpenAI and Google, the study reveals remarkable capabilities in financial reasoning.
Benchmarking Against CFA Standards
Measuring AI performance against the CFA Level III exam represents a significant leap forward. This level is known for testing nuanced skills in portfolio management and ethical considerations. With past studies indicating that AI could only meet the requirements of Levels I and II, Level III serves as a critical barometer for assessing the adaptability of AI in real-world scenarios.
Key Insights from the Evaluation
Goodfin's study presents several enlightening findings:
- Professional-level Reasoning: AI models like Claude Opus 4 and Gemini 2.5 Pro achieved remarkable results, showing they can pass the CFA Level III without domain-specific training.
- Distinctive Performance in Essays: While many models excelled in multiple-choice formats, few managed to tackle the complex essay prompts, which require deeper analytical skills.
- Importance of Prompting Techniques: Techniques that encouraged step-by-step reasoning improved the accuracy of AI responses, emphasizing the significance of how information is presented to the models.
- Trade-offs in AI Accuracy: The most accurate models incurred higher operational costs, presenting vital considerations for practical applications in financial services.
- Complementary Role of AI: Although AI provides consistent answers, it lacks the ability to interpret nuanced human contexts, making the human advisor's role crucial in a blended model.
To ensure credibility, Goodfin engaged certified CFA graders to meticulously evaluate AI outputs, demonstrating a commitment to reducing bias and confirming robust evaluation methods.
